Some RK3399 boards, such as newer revisions of NanoPi R4S, do not
provide an EEPROM chip containing a globally unique MAC address.

Currently, this means that a randomly generated temporary MAC address
may be generated each time the device is rebooted, leading to ARP cache
issues and other confusing bugs.

Since RK3399 CPUs provide a built-in unique serial number, we can
reliably derive a locally MAC address from it by reading the
corresponding bits from the non-secure efuse block.

Port from uboot-rockchip 0c294d0, fix compilation issues and adjust
coding style.

+static void setup_macaddr(void)
+{
+       if (!IS_ENABLED(CONFIG_CMD_NET))
+               return;
+
+       int ret;
+       const char *cpuid = env_get("cpuid#");
+       u8 hash[SHA256_SUM_LEN];
+       int size = sizeof(hash);
+       u8 mac_addr[6];
+
+       /* Only generate a MAC address if none is set in the environment */
+       if (env_get("ethaddr"))
+               return;
+
+       if (!cpuid) {
+               debug("%s: could not retrieve 'cpuid#'\n", __func__);
+               return;
+       }
+
+       ret = hash_block("sha256", (void *)cpuid, strlen(cpuid), hash, &size);
+       if (ret) {
+               debug("%s: failed to calculate SHA256\n", __func__);
+               return;
+       }
+
+       /* Copy 6 bytes of the hash to base the MAC address on */
+       memcpy(mac_addr, hash, 6);
+
+       /* Make this a valid MAC address and set it */
+       mac_addr[0] &= 0xfe;  /* clear multicast bit */
+       mac_addr[0] |= 0x02;  /* set local assignment bit (IEEE802) */
+       eth_env_set_enetaddr("ethaddr", mac_addr);
+}
+
+static void setup_serial(void)
+{
+       if (!IS_ENABLED(CONFIG_ROCKCHIP_EFUSE))
+               return;
+
+       struct udevice *dev;
+       int ret, i;
+       u8 cpuid[RK3399_CPUID_LEN];
+       u8 low[RK3399_CPUID_LEN / 2], high[RK3399_CPUID_LEN / 2];
+       char cpuid_str[RK3399_CPUID_LEN * 2 + 1];
+       u64 serialno;
+       char serialno_str[16];
+
+       /* retrieve the device */
+       ret = uclass_get_device_by_driver(UCLASS_MISC,
+                                         DM_DRIVER_GET(rockchip_efuse), &dev);
+       if (ret) {
+               debug("%s: could not find efuse device\n", __func__);
+               return;
+       }
+
+       /* read the cpu_id range from the efuses */
+       ret = misc_read(dev, RK3399_CPUID_OFF, &cpuid, sizeof(cpuid));
+       if (ret) {
+               debug("%s: reading cpuid from the efuses failed\n",
+                     __func__);
+               return;
+       }
+
+       memset(cpuid_str, 0, sizeof(cpuid_str));
+       for (i = 0; i < 16; i++)
+               sprintf(&cpuid_str[i * 2], "%02x", cpuid[i]);
+
+       debug("cpuid: %s\n", cpuid_str);
+
+       /*
+        * Mix the cpuid bytes using the same rules as in
+        *   ${linux}/drivers/soc/rockchip/rockchip-cpuinfo.c
+        */
+       for (i = 0; i < 8; i++) {
+               low[i] = cpuid[1 + (i << 1)];
+               high[i] = cpuid[i << 1];
+       }
+
+       serialno = crc32_no_comp(0, low, 8);
+       serialno |= (u64)crc32_no_comp(serialno, high, 8) << 32;
+       snprintf(serialno_str, sizeof(serialno_str), "%llx", serialno);
+
+       env_set("cpuid#", cpuid_str);
+       env_set("serial#", serialno_str);
+}
+
+int misc_init_r(void)
+{
+       setup_serial();
+       setup_macaddr();
+
+       return 0;
+}
